Pre-purchase checklist
- Match the VIN on the dash, door jamb and title — they must be identical.
- Cold-start the engine; listen for knocks and check for blue or white exhaust smoke.
- Test-drive through all gears at low and highway speed — no slipping, shudder or pulling.
- Confirm every warning light clears at startup (none should stay on).
- Check fluids — oil, coolant, transmission — for level, color and leaks.
- Look underneath for rust, fresh undercoating or signs of collision repair.
- Always get an independent pre-purchase inspection from a trusted mechanic.

VEHICLE CONSUMES LARGE AMOUNTS OF OIL. MOST OIL BURNS AND RELEASES FROM THE EXHAUST WHEN DRIVING.. ENGINE REQUIRES A REPLACEMENT FROM BMW.
NHTSA ODI #11341512POWER TRAIN,ENGINE
THERE IS WHITE SMOKE THAT IS COMING OUT OF THE BACK PIPES OF THE CAR. THE CAR IS BURNING THROUGH OIL. I AM PUTTING A QUART IN EVERY 2 -3 WEEKS. MY MECHANIC SAID THAT IT IS HAVING THE SAME PROBLEMS AS THE 2009 MODEL. THE 2009 750I HAS BEEN RECALLED TO FIX THE ENGINE PROBLEM AND I HAVE A 2012 MODEL. THE SMOKE COMES OUT WHEN I AM DRIVING NOT WHEN IT IS STATION…

THE TRANSFER CASE ON MY CAR STUTTERS WHEN ACCELERATING FROM A STOPPED POSITION OR UNDER MODERATE TO HEAVY BREAKING. TRACTION ON SNOW BECOMES LIMITED BECAUSE THE STUTTERING CAUSE TIRES TO HAVE MORE OR LESS POWER SPONTANEOUSLY. THIS STUTTERING WAS CONFIRMED TO BE A DEFECTIVE TRANSFER CASE WHEN UNPLUGGING THE TRANSFER CASE MODULE. BMW CONFIRMED THE TRANSFER CA…
